Try-square


noun
1.
a device for testing the squareness of carpentry work or the like, or for laying out right angles, consisting of a pair of straightedges fixed at right angles to one another.
noun
1.
a device for testing or laying out right angles, usually consisting of a metal blade fixed at right angles to a wooden handle
